Jump onboard Ocean Extreme's smallest most personal vessel for a unique boutique whale watching experience. This vessel has a capacity of only 12 passengers making it the smallest whale watching tour available in Sydney.
Experience the thrill of whale watching on a small RIB, offering an intimate and exhilarating adventure that larger vessels can't match. Our high-speed boat ensures you reach prime whale-watching areas quickly, maximizing your time with these magnificent creatures. The tour is led by an experienced crew who provide informative commentary on the whales' behaviors and the marine environment. This unique combination of speed, comfort, and expert guidance ensures an unforgettable and immersive whale-watching experience.

Itinerary
- Whale Watching Search Area (15 - 100 minutes): Description: Once out at sea, our crew will guide you in spotting humpback whales and other marine wildlife. Learn about the whales' behaviors, including breaching, tail-slapping, and spouting. This is the highlight of the tour, offering a chance to witness these magnificent creatures up close. Time Spent: 85 minutes Return Journey (100-120 minutes): Description: On the return trip, relax and enjoy the high-speed ride back to Circular Quay, taking in the beautiful coastline and harbor views. Time Spent: 20 minutes
- Circular Quay (0 - 2 minutes): Description: Begin your adventure at the iconic Circular Quay. As we depart, enjoy stunning views of the Sydney Opera House and Harbour Bridge. Time Spent: 2 minutes Sydney Harbour Highlights (2 - 12 minutes): Description: Cruise past historic Fort Denison, the Royal Botanic Garden, and Mrs. Macquarie's Chair. Capture picturesque views of these landmarks as we make our way toward Sydney Heads. Time Spent 10 minutes Sydney Heads (12-15 minutes): Description: Experience the thrill of passing through the dramatic cliffs of North and South Head as we head into the open ocean.
